学会asp后再学php,九天学会ASP 之 第二天

学习目的:学会用表单元素向服务器传送变量,然后显示变量在客户端的浏览器。

首先,让我们来看一下DREAMWEAVER的表单元素。

ae12f4583e193108b4b8cdd1f056f546.gif

6d598bc7fc87d613ecb4160a4fb019a7.png

现在我们来一个个看表单元素:

文本域,这个是最基本的,传送的是文本信息,一般用户名,密码都要用这个传送,不过要是密码的话要在类型里面选择密码,这样就会以*代替显示出来的字符,文本域的名字很重要,以后会用到这个名字所以一般不用默认的名字。

举一个例子:如果文本域的名字是name的话,用来传送网上用户登记的名字,在表单域里面,传送到reg.asp,用POST方法,那么在reg.asp里面这样得到变量如果要显示变量再加一句,response.write

name,这样就形成了一个从客户端到浏览器再回到客户端的过程。如果方法用的是GET的话,那么就改为name=request.querystring("name")实际上两者可以统一为name=request("name")。

再看看按钮,按钮里面无非两种,一种是提交表单的按钮,一种是重新输入的按钮。单选按钮,一个按钮有一个值。在列表里面同样,添加列表选项和值。

举一个例子,实际上各种表单元素都是差不多的,下面是DREAMWEAVER里面的代码,保存为“index.asp”:

姓名:

//文本框,名称为name

密码:

//文本框,用来输入密码,名称为psw

性别:

//单选,名称为sex,数值是"男"

//单选,名称为sex,数值是"女"

城市:

上海

北京

//复选框,名称为city


备注:

//文本区,名称为content

//提交按钮

再把以下代码保存为“reg.asp”:

name=request.form("name")

psw=request.form("psw")

sex=request.form("sex")

city=request.form("city")

content=request.form("content")

response.write name&"
"

response.write psw&"
"

response.write sex&"
"

response.write city&"
"

response.write content

%>提交后显示如下图:

c5fdcbf2f51a8d576be20eff2d0adae0.png

d932680b4a6e253c5cf59d8ac26133b1.gifname=request.form("name")

前面的name为变量,要跟response.write

后面的变量名name一样才可以。request.form("name")这里的name是要跟index.asp中姓名的文本框名称

type="text" name="name"> 一样才可以。在response.write name&"
"后面的“&”是“与”、“并且”的意思,“"
"”是HTML代码中的换行的意思,也就是说在后面加&"
"的意思是在每个变量后面都换行,如果不加的话也能显示,不过这些内容都会显示在同一行了。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值